    Understanding the Role of an Automotive Locksmith

    Automotive locksmiths are specialized professionals trained to handle a wide range of vehicle-related lock and key issues. Their expertise includes:

    • Key Duplication: Creating duplicates for spare keys.
    • Key Cutting: Cutting new keys based on a vehicle's specifications.
    • Transponder Keys: Programming keys that have embedded chips for security.
    • Lockout Services: Assisting when drivers accidentally lock their keys inside their vehicles.
    • Ignition Repair: Fixing or replacing faulty ignition switches.
    • Remote Key Fob Services: Replacing or programming key fobs used for keyless entry.

    Why You May Need a Locksmith for Car Keys

    Several scenarios might necessitate the services of an automotive locksmith:

    1. Lost Keys: One of the most common issues. Losing your car keys can be inconvenient and stressful.
    2. Broken Keys: Keys can break in locks or ignitions, rendering them useless.
    3. Locked Out: Accidental lockouts happen to the best of us; a locksmith can help you regain access to your vehicle.
    4. Faulty Ignition: A malfunctioning ignition can prevent your vehicle from starting.
    5. Stolen Keys: If your keys are stolen, rekeying your locks or replacing your ignition may be necessary for security.

    Services Offered by Automotive Locksmiths

    Automotive locksmiths provide a variety of services tailored to meet the needs of vehicle owners. These services include, but are not limited to:

    • Emergency Lockout Assistance: Immediate help for drivers locked out of their vehicles.
    • Key Replacement and Duplication: Quick replacement of lost or broken keys and creation of duplicates.
    • Transponder Key Programming: Specialized programming for modern vehicles with electronic keys.
    • Ignition Repair and Replacement: Services to address ignition issues that prevent starting.
    • Remote Key Fob Programming: Programming new or replacement remote fobs for keyless entry.

    FAQs about Automotive Locksmiths

    1. How much does it cost to hire a locksmith for car keys?

    • The cost can vary based on services rendered and your location. Generally, expect to pay between £50 to £300, depending on the complexity of the job.

    2. Can locksmiths make a key from a lock?

    • Yes, many locksmiths can create a key from an existing lock, although it’s typically more efficient to provide the V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) or an existing key.

    3. What if I have a keyless entry system?

    • Most automotive locksmiths are equipped to handle keyless entry systems, including programming new remote key fobs.

    4. Are locksmiths available during emergencies?

    • Many automotive locksmiths operate 24/7, providing emergency services for lockouts and other urgent situations.

    5. Do I need to go to a dealership for a new car key?

    • Not necessarily. While dealerships can provide replacement keys, automotive locksmiths can often do this at a lower cost and with faster service.
